Especificações
| Atributo | Valor |
| Supplier | Infineon Technologies |
| Package | Tape & Reel (TR),Cut Tape (CT) |
| ProductStatus | Obsolete |
| Frequency | 1.575GHz |
| Gain | 18dB |
| NoiseFigure | 0.9dB |
| RFType | GPS |
| Voltage-Supply | 2.4V ~ 3.2V |
| Current-Supply | 5.6mA |
| MountingType | Surface Mount |
| Package/Case | 6-XFDFN Exposed Pad |
